The best first balance bike represents a revolutionary approach to teaching young children the fundamentals of cycling while building confidence and coordination. These innovative two-wheeled vehicles eliminate traditional pedals and training wheels, allowing children aged 18 months to 5 years to focus purely on balance and steering. The best first balance bike features a lightweight aluminum or steel frame designed to withstand daily adventures while remaining manageable for small hands and bodies. Advanced models incorporate adjustable seat heights ranging from 12 to 16 inches, accommodating growing children and extending the bike's useful lifespan. The handlebars feature ergonomic grips with safety end caps to prevent injury during falls, while the steering mechanism includes a limited turning radius to prevent over-steering accidents. Premium balance bikes showcase puncture-proof EVA foam tires or air-filled rubber tires that provide excellent traction on various surfaces including pavement, grass, and dirt paths. The frame geometry emphasizes a low center of gravity, making it easier for children to place their feet firmly on the ground for stability and confidence. Many top-tier models include quick-release seat clamps for tool-free adjustments, allowing parents to modify the bike's fit as their child grows. The best first balance bike applications extend beyond basic transportation, serving as an effective learning tool for developing gross motor skills, spatial awareness, and risk assessment abilities. These bikes prove invaluable in playground environments, neighborhood sidewalks, and park pathways where children can safely explore their mobility limits. The absence of complex mechanical components like chains, gears, or brakes simplifies maintenance while reducing potential safety hazards. Quality construction ensures durability through multiple children and various weather conditions, making the best first balance bike a worthwhile long-term investment for families prioritizing active outdoor play and foundational cycling skills.

The best first balance bike delivers numerous practical benefits that make it an exceptional choice for families seeking to introduce their children to cycling safely and effectively. Parents appreciate how these bikes eliminate the fear factor associated with traditional bicycles, as children maintain complete control over their speed and stopping ability using their feet. This natural braking method builds confidence while allowing children to progress at their own comfortable pace without external pressure or assistance. The lightweight design, typically weighing between 6 to 8 pounds, enables children to easily maneuver and control their bike, fostering independence and self-reliance from early ages. Unlike traditional training wheel bicycles, the best first balance bike teaches proper balance techniques immediately, eliminating the need for later relearning and adjustment periods when transitioning to pedal bikes. Children who master balance bikes typically learn to ride pedal bicycles 6 months faster than those using training wheels, demonstrating the effectiveness of this learning approach. The adjustable components ensure extended usability, with most quality balance bikes accommodating children for 2-3 years of growth, providing excellent value for money compared to multiple bike purchases. Safety features integrated into the best first balance bike design significantly reduce injury risks, with rounded edges, impact-resistant materials, and stable geometry protecting children during learning phases. The simple mechanical design requires minimal maintenance, saving parents time and money on repairs while ensuring reliable performance throughout the bike's lifespan. These bikes promote physical activity and outdoor exploration, combating sedentary lifestyle trends while developing core strength, coordination, and cardiovascular fitness in young children. The social benefits emerge as children gain confidence riding alongside peers, participating in family bike outings, and developing a positive relationship with cycling that often continues into adulthood. Environmental consciousness grows as families choose sustainable transportation alternatives and children learn to appreciate outdoor activities over screen-based entertainment. The best first balance bike serves as an excellent foundation for developing risk assessment skills, as children learn to navigate obstacles, judge distances, and make quick decisions in safe, controlled environments.

Revolutionary No-Pedal Learning System

Revolutionary No-Pedal Learning System

The most distinctive advantage of the best first balance bike lies in its revolutionary no-pedal design that fundamentally transforms how children learn to ride. This innovative approach eliminates the traditional dependency on training wheels or adult assistance, allowing children to develop natural balance instincts through self-directed exploration and practice. The absence of pedals forces children to focus entirely on the essential skill of balance, which forms the foundation of all future cycling abilities. Research conducted by pediatric development specialists demonstrates that children using balance bikes develop superior balance skills compared to those learning with training wheels, as they experience authentic weight distribution and momentum management from the beginning. The no-pedal system encourages children to use their feet as natural brakes and propulsion, creating an intuitive learning environment that mirrors their existing walking and running abilities. This familiar movement pattern reduces learning anxiety and accelerates skill acquisition, as children can immediately understand how to start, stop, and control their speed without complex mechanical instructions. The best first balance bike capitalizes on children's natural learning preferences by allowing them to experiment with gliding distances and coasting speeds at their own comfort level. Advanced riders often achieve impressive gliding distances of 50-100 feet, demonstrating mastery of balance principles that translate directly to pedal bike success. The psychological benefits prove equally significant, as children experience immediate success and progress recognition, building self-confidence and motivation to continue practicing. Parents frequently report that their children show increased enthusiasm for outdoor activities and physical challenges after mastering the balance bike, indicating broader developmental benefits beyond cycling skills. The no-pedal learning system also eliminates common training wheel dependencies that can actually hinder balance development by providing false stability cues. Children transition from balance bikes to pedal bikes with remarkable ease, often requiring only minutes to adapt to pedaling while maintaining their established balance skills, proving the effectiveness of this foundational learning approach.
Premium Safety Engineering and Child-Centric Design

Premium Safety Engineering and Child-Centric Design

Safety engineering represents the cornerstone of the best first balance bike design philosophy, incorporating multiple layers of protection that prioritize child wellbeing without compromising learning effectiveness. The frame construction utilizes high-grade materials with rounded edges and smooth welds that eliminate sharp contact points where injuries might occur during falls or collisions. Advanced impact-absorbing technologies integrate into critical contact areas, including padded handlebars and protective steering limiters that prevent over-rotation accidents common with traditional bicycles. The geometry of the best first balance bike positions children in an optimal riding stance that promotes natural balance while maintaining easy ground contact for confidence and safety. Seat heights adjust to accommodate proper leg extension while ensuring both feet can touch the ground simultaneously, providing stable support during mounting, dismounting, and emergency stops. The handlebar design incorporates ergonomic grips specifically sized for small hands, featuring non-slip surfaces and protective end caps that cushion impact forces during falls. Quality balance bikes implement chain guard equivalents and spoke protectors that prevent clothing entanglement and finger injuries, addressing common childhood accident scenarios. The steering mechanism includes intelligent limitation systems that prevent handlebar rotation beyond safe angles, reducing the risk of sudden directional changes that could cause loss of control. Tire selection focuses on providing optimal grip across various surfaces while maintaining appropriate rolling resistance for safe speed control, with many premium models offering puncture-resistant construction for reliability and safety. Reflective elements and bright color schemes enhance visibility during outdoor play, helping parents and other cyclists notice young riders in various lighting conditions. The low center of gravity design minimizes tip-over risks while the stable wheelbase configuration prevents common stability issues that plague poorly designed balance bikes. Manufacturing standards exceed traditional toy safety requirements, with rigorous testing protocols that simulate years of typical use patterns and abuse scenarios that active children might create during normal play activities.
Adjustable Growth Technology for Extended Value

Adjustable Growth Technology for Extended Value

The sophisticated adjustable growth technology integrated into the best first balance bike represents a significant advancement in children's cycling equipment, providing exceptional value through extended usability periods that accommodate rapidly growing children. The centerpiece of this technology involves precision-engineered seat adjustment systems that offer height ranges typically spanning 4-6 inches, allowing the bike to adapt as children grow from toddlers to school-age riders. Quick-release mechanisms enable tool-free adjustments that parents can make in seconds, encouraging regular fit optimization that maintains proper riding posture and safety throughout the bike's lifespan. The handlebar height adjustment systems complement seat modifications, ensuring that children maintain appropriate arm positioning and steering control as their proportions change with growth. Premium balance bikes incorporate measurement guides and sizing indicators that help parents determine optimal adjustment settings based on their child's current dimensions and developmental stage. The growth accommodation technology extends beyond simple height adjustments to include consideration for changing motor skills and confidence levels, with some models offering different riding positions that progress from beginner-friendly to more advanced configurations. The engineering behind these adjustment systems prioritizes both security and ease of use, with robust clamping mechanisms that prevent unintentional movement while remaining accessible for routine modifications. This adaptability translates into exceptional economic value, as families typically utilize the best first balance bike for 2-3 years per child, often passing functional bikes to younger siblings or reselling them with retained value. The extended usability period allows children to fully master balance skills without outgrowing their equipment prematurely, ensuring complete learning cycles and skill development. Quality construction materials and components withstand repeated adjustments without compromising structural integrity or safety performance, maintaining like-new functionality throughout extended use periods. The growth technology also accommodates different learning phases, allowing conservative initial settings for nervous beginners that can be modified to more challenging configurations as confidence and ability develop. Parent feedback consistently highlights the convenience and cost-effectiveness of adjustable balance bikes compared to purchasing multiple fixed-size alternatives, with many families reporting satisfaction with their investment over multiple years of active use.
